Is Someone Keeping Count?

Let us take a tally of the actions:

The first lawsuit that David and Clem filed cost the Métis people – the Canadian Taxpayers through Federal Resources in excess of $90,000 as was reported by one of the Board of Governors. The court injunction said the Board of Govorners was not allowed to meet until an election was hosted for the President. The election was slated for mid October. David Chartrand could not count on getting Clem elected with the voting delegates at the assembly so he phyla-busted the meeting and we went back to square one. No election, no leader, no direction, no meeting and we are in worst shape then ever. Government says no money – in fact they are getting very nervous under their accountability measures at the Federal dollars being used in vexatious lawsuits which do not meet the stink test for the contribution agreements that have been signed by MNC. We have to lay off staff and have only a couple of people wrapping up remaining agreements.

There was more credit extended to pay the staff out the severance, holiday pay and overtime commitments that they had. But now I need to ask – Did David and Clem come into a new win fall? – They have filed another frivolous law suit that is requesting that the court put Clem in without the election meeting because it is detrimental to the organization not to have a President. (Please remember David claims he is doing this for democracy - now democracy is the Federal courts selecting our president for us!) The lawsuit is against the Métis National Council and the four other governing members.
